Output 803f62e4ec9cb728cb53d1d34365e0585c423fe6ed90b93555f9e0df7d8e7348:1

value
315231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da75a1d009195ce4f82bfcc2dc0b1638e967a6d5 OP_EQUAL
address
3Mc89amaPSRhk2P5rhPcft6VX5FeJQKtpz
transaction
803f62e4ec9cb728cb53d1d34365e0585c423fe6ed90b93555f9e0df7d8e7348
spent
true